Direct estimates of nitrogen abundance for Seyfert 2 nuclei

Published 22 May 2024 in astro-ph.GA | (2405.13906v1)

Abstract: We derive the nitrogen and oxygen abundances in the Narrow Line Regions (NLRs) of a sample of 38 local ($z : < : 0.4$) Seyfert~2 nuclei. For that, we consider narrow optical emission line intensities and direct estimates of the electron temperatures ($T_{\rm e}$-method). We find nitrogen abundances in the range $7.6 : < : \rm 12+log(N/H) : < : 8.6$ (mean value $8.06\pm0.22$) or $\rm 0.4 : < : (N/N_{\odot}) : < 4.7$, in the metallicity regime $8.3 : < : \rm 12+log(O/H) : < : 9.0$. Our results indicate that the dispersion in N/H abundance for a fixed O/H value in AGNs is in agreement with that for disc \ion{H}{ii} regions with similar metallicity. We show that Seyfert~2 nuclei follow a similar (N/O)-(O/H) relation to the one followed by star-forming objects. Finally, we find that active galaxies called as 'nitrogen-loud' observed at very high redshift ($z : > : 5$) show N/O values in consonance with those derived for local NLRs. This result indicates that the main star-formation event is completed in the early evolution stages of active galaxies.
